Poker Stars, $0.02/$0.05 No Limit Hold'em Cash, 6 Players
Poker Tools Powered By Holdem Manager - The Ultimate Poker Software Suite.

Hero (SB): $6.01 (120.2 bb)
BB: $15.87 (317.4 bb)
UTG: $5.07 (101.4 bb)
MP: $4.91 (98.2 bb)
CO: $14.95 (299 bb)
BTN: $5 (100 bb)

Preflop: Hero is SB with T T
UTG raises to $0.15, MP folds, CO calls $0.15, BTN raises to $0.40, Hero calls $0.38, 2 folds, CO calls $0.25

Preflop : I'm getting 2:1 on a call and since he had a full stack, i assume i can get all his money in case I hit a set.

Flop: ($1.40) 9 J 8 (3 players)
Hero checks, CO checks, BTN bets $0.36, Hero raises to $0.90, CO folds, BTN calls $0.54

Flop : I flop an open ender and check, villain raises small so i check raise assuming he is on a one card flush draw or perhaps he bet small on an overpair because of the texture of the board.

Turn: ($3.20) 7 (2 players)
Hero bets $2, BTN raises to $3.70 and is all-in, Hero calls $1.70

Turn : I hit my straight and bet about 2/3rds of the pot. Villain raises all in and at this point i'm pretty much committed and so I call.

River: ($10.60) 9 (2 players, 1 is all-in)

Pre-flop call is fine. Postflop I would only c/c.
It is very unlikely he would fold there better hands and I´m not sure you want to play there stacks. Although against that small bet I would also tend to c/r for value.
Since you hit your draw then b/c turn is fine. He may still get all-in his flushdraws or have Tx himself
